<p><&sol;p>&NewLine;<div>&NewLine;<p>Aliyu Audu&comma; a Senior Special Assistant to <a target&equals;"&lowbar;blank" href&equals;"http&colon;&sol;&sol;gistreel&period;com&sol;tag&sol;tinubu"><strong>President Bola Tinubu<&sol;strong><&sol;a> on Public Affairs&comma; has resigned from his position&comma; citing deep concerns over the growing defection of politicians to the ruling All Progressives Congress &lpar;APC&rpar; and warning that Nigeria is on the brink of becoming a one-party state&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p>Audu submitted his resignation on Sunday&comma; June 8&comma; through the Chief of Staff&comma; <a target&equals;"&lowbar;blank" href&equals;"http&colon;&sol;&sol;gistreel&period;com&sol;tag&sol;Femi-Gbajabiamila"><strong>Femi Gbajabiamila<&sol;strong><&sol;a>&comma; stating that his decision was effective immediately&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p>In a strongly worded resignation letter&comma; Audu expressed unease over the increasing number of governors&comma; legal figures&comma; and opposition politicians who <strong>have joined the APC in recent months<&sol;strong>&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p><em>&OpenCurlyDoubleQuote;Though I do not align with the PDP&comma; I refuse to be used directly or indirectly as an instrument to reduce Nigeria to a one-party state&period; That would be a betrayal of both divine favour and democratic principle&comma;”<&sol;em> Audu said&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p>In a separate statement released after stepping down&comma; Audu clarified that his move was not an act of rebellion&comma; but rather a matter of conscience and a commitment to preserving Nigeria’s democratic integrity&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p><em>&OpenCurlyDoubleQuote;Leaders owe it to God to protect the values and justice within the system&period; Though I am stepping down&comma; I will continue to support the government in power to work towards a better Nigeria&comma;”<&sol;em> he added&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p>Audu also aimed at the growing political partnership between President Tinubu and Federal Capital Territory Minister <a target&equals;"&lowbar;blank" href&equals;"http&colon;&sol;&sol;gistreel&period;com&sol;tag&sol;Nyesom-Wike"><strong>Nyesom Wike<&sol;strong><&sol;a>&comma; calling it an &OpenCurlyDoubleQuote;unholy alliance” that undermines the ideals of progressivism&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p><em>&OpenCurlyDoubleQuote;We just differ on political views&comma; as I pride myself with being a progressive and a promoter of democratic values which seems to be lost in the unholy alliance of PBAT with Wike&comma;”<&sol;em> he said&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p>Despite stepping away from his official role&comma; Audu signalled his continued engagement in Nigeria’s political landscape&comma; adding a humorous note&colon;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p><em>&OpenCurlyDoubleQuote;That does not mean our gbas gbos will seize o&period; We are still here for the attacks and counterattacks&period; Oya Agbadorians&comma; over to you&period;”<&sol;em><&sol;p>&NewLine;<&sol;p><&sol;div>&NewLine;<p><a href&equals;"https&colon;&sol;&sol;www&period;gistreel&period;com&sol;tinubus-aide-aliyu-audu-resigns-labels-wikes-alliance-unholy&sol;" previewlistener&equals;"true">Source link <&sol;a><&sol;p>&NewLine;
